Activating xvYCC
Setting the xvYCC mode to On increases detail and color space when watching
movies from an external device (ie. DVD player) connected to the HDMI or
Component IN jacks.
1 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select xvYCC, then press the ENTER button.
0 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select Off or On.
Press the ENTER button.
xvYCC is available when the picture mode is set to Movie, and the
external input is set to HDMI or Component mode.
Configuring Picture Options
Activating Picture Options
1
Press the MENU button to display the menu.
Press the ENTER button to select Picture.

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select Picture Options, then press the ENTER
button.

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select a particular item. Press the ENTER button.
When you are satisfied with your setting, press the ENTER button.
In PC mode, you can only make changes to the Color Tone, Position,
Size and Color Gamut from among the items in Picture Options.
Adjusting the Color Tone
1
Follow the Activating Picture Options instructions numbers 1 and 2.

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select Color Tone, then press the ENTER button.

Press the ▲ or ▼ button to select Cool, Cool1, Normal, Warm1 or Warm.
Press the ENTER button.
Warm1 or Warm is only activated when the picture mode is Movie.
Settings can be adjusted and stored for each external device
you have connected to an input of the TV.
